
The search for a missing Fairhaven woman resumed on Tuesday, as Anapaula Huggins, 43, had disappeared on Monday while walking her dog near Pope Beach on Manhattan Avenue around 7:30 am. Her family later found the dog alone. First responders, including police boats and K-9 units, are looking for Huggins in the shoreline and the water of the Acushnet River and surrounding areas. Huggins is 5 feet, 8 inches tall, has long black hair, and was last seen wearing a maroon jacket and black pants. Fairhaven police are encouraging residents in the area to check their surveillance footage and are asking anyone with information about her whereabouts to call them.
